WebAug 6, 2024 · Find the USB Root Hub and right-click it Select Properties to open a new window In this new window, choose the Power Management tab Uncheck Allow the computer to turn off this device to save power Click OK to save your changes, and repeat this for all Root Hubs You may need to restart your computer for this to take effect. WebAug 12, 2024 · A USB port hub is a small adapter that’s equipped with several extra USB ports. It’s an easy way to expand the number of available USB ports on your computer. USB hubs typically contain 3 to 7 extra ports. If you have an HP laptop that has 3 built-in USB ports and you plug in a 7-port hub, you’ll have 9 total USB ports available on your ...

WebMethod 2: Restart the computer. If scanning for new hardware did not fix the problem, try restarting the computer. After the computer has restarted, check the USB device to see whether it is working. If restarting the computer fixed the problem, you are finished. If this method did not fix the problem, go to Method 3.
